Responsibilities of Position

This position performs emergency and non-emergency telephone and two-way radio communication work for police, fire, and ambulance services and related work as required.

Candidates are required to complete the following steps to be considered for the position:

1.Apply through this posting.

2.METCAD Hiring Manager will contact you directly to confirm eligibility and hiring process steps below (testing fees waived for experience applicants):

a. NTN Testing-E-Comm (passing scores of: Call Taker/53, Notes/64, Dispatch/43)

b. NTN Typing Test (6000/kph with at least 90% accuracy)

c. NTN Computer Simulations

d. Attestation signed

Candidates successfully passing the steps above, will then be invited to move through the remainder of the hiring process which may include:

1.In-person interviews.

2.Reference and background checks.

3.Contingent offer of employment.

4.Job preview sit along with a current Telecommunicator.

5.Drug screening, hearing test, psychological evaluation, and a fingerprint-based criminal history check.

6.Confirmed offer of employment.

Required Qualifications:

  • Must be 18 years or older by date of hire.

  • U.S. Citizen, or legally authorized to work in the United States (must meet I-9 requirements at time of hire).

  • High School diploma, or equivalent by date of hire.

  • Ability to work shifts, weekends, holidays, and overtime.

  • Ability to solve problems and provide excellent customer service in stressful situations.

  • Ability to acquire mandated certifications (i.e. Law Enforcement Agency Data Systems, Emergency Medical Dispatch, National Incident Management Systems) during the training phase.

  • Experience with dispatching, customer service, and computer use are preferred.

Starting salary range is $29.44 to $32.51 per hour, DOQ. Employees may qualify for salary increases based on performance and/or longevity.
